Features to Look for in a Recliner Chair with Wheels
Key Features to Consider for Optimal Office Comfort
When selecting a recliner chair for office use, there are several crucial features that can greatly enhance comfort and productivity. The focus is not only on comfort, but also on mobility and functionality, which are essential for the dynamic office environment.- Adjustability: Look for recliner chairs that are adjustable. Chairs with adjustable seat depth, height, and angles allow each employee to find their ideal seating position, accommodating their individual ergonomic needs. This personalization can significantly contribute to productivity by reducing strain and discomfort.
- Weight Capacity and Durability: It's essential to choose a product that matches the weight capacity requirements of the office. Many chairs offer a capacity of up to 300 lbs or more, proving suitable for a robust office setting. Heavy duty recliner chairs with wheels ensure long-lasting durability even with frequent use.
- Seat Width and Depth: The dimensions of the chair, including seat width and seat depth, play a vital role in the comfort offered to users. A wider and deeper seat can provide more support, enhancing the ergonomic benefits.
- Mobile Features: Chairs with wheels offer the necessary mobility for flexible workspace arrangements. This feature is particularly beneficial in dynamic office environments, where furniture needs to be rearranged to suit different tasks throughout the day.
- Lumbar and Back Support: Recliner chairs that come with built-in lumbar support are advantageous for promoting good posture and reducing back pain. This is particularly crucial for employees who spend long hours seated.
